dc.description.abstractThe Challenger gold deposit in South Australia is hosted by pelitic migmatites that underwent peak metamorphism at ∼7.5 ± 1.5 kbars and at least 800°C. Nd model ages suggest a protolith age of ∼2900 Ma. Zircon U-Pb and garnet Sm-Nd dating indicates
